前提・実現したいこと
C言語で行列式を表現したいのですが、segmaentation faultが表示されてしまいます。理由、対処法をご教授願えると幸いです。
発生している問題・エラーメッセージ
./a.out A= Segmentation fault: 11 となってしまいます。
該当のソースコード
C言語
1ソースコード
#include<stdio.h>
#define row 3
#define col 4
int main(void){
int i,j;
int A[row][col], B[row][col];
for(i=0;i<row;i++){
for (j=0;j<col;j++){
A[i][j] = i*col+j+1;
}
}
printf("A=\n");
for(i=0;i<row;i++){
for(j=0;i<col;j++){
printf("%4d", A[i][j]);
}
printf("\n");
}
return 0;
}
>(c言語)
であればC++とC#は無関係なので質問タグから外してください。
あと、コードやエラーはマークダウンのcode機能を利用してご提示ください。
https://teratail.com/questions/238564
承知しました。申し訳ないです。
怒ってるわけではなくあくまで「質問への追記修正依頼」です。
質問修正してご対応ください。
(あくまで他人ですし何の前触れもなくここで感情的になることは殆どないです。)
こちらこそすみませんでした。
ご丁寧にリンクもありがとうございました。助かりました。
質問は修正できますので。
解決後も質問は後から同じような問題を抱えた人の参考になるものですので、
質問タグはそのままキーワードともなりますし、今からでも調整されたほうが良いと思います。
↑失礼、対応されましたね。入れ違いになりました。
回答2件
あなたの回答
tips
プレビュー